In the rapidly evolving world of laptops, choosing the right device can be challenging. The Acer Swift Go 14 2026 and Samsung Galaxy Book 3 Pro are two top contenders, each offering unique features tailored for different users. This article compares these two models to help you decide which is the better choice for your needs.
Design and Build Quality
The Acer Swift Go 14 2026 boasts a sleek, lightweight aluminum chassis, making it highly portable. Its minimalist design appeals to professionals and students alike. The Samsung Galaxy Book 3 Pro also features a premium build with a slim profile and a durable metal body, emphasizing elegance and portability.
Display and Graphics
Both laptops offer stunning displays, but with different strengths. The Acer Swift Go 14 2026 has a 14-inch 2.8K OLED display with a 120Hz refresh rate, providing vibrant colors and smooth visuals. The Samsung Galaxy Book 3 Pro features a 13.3-inch 4K AMOLED display, delivering exceptional clarity and color accuracy, ideal for creative work.
Performance and Hardware
The Acer Swift Go 14 2026 is powered by Intel's latest Core i7 processors and up to 16GB of RAM, ensuring robust performance for multitasking and demanding applications. It also offers options for dedicated graphics, such as NVIDIA GeForce MX series.
The Samsung Galaxy Book 3 Pro runs on Intel's Core i7 or i5 processors with up to 16GB of RAM. It integrates Intel Iris Xe graphics, suitable for light gaming and creative tasks. Both devices provide fast SSD storage options, enhancing overall responsiveness.
Battery Life and Portability
The Acer Swift Go 14 2026 offers up to 12 hours of battery life, making it suitable for on-the-go use. Its lightweight design (around 1.2 kg) adds to its portability.
The Samsung Galaxy Book 3 Pro provides approximately 10-11 hours of battery life. Its slim profile and lightweight construction (about 1.2 kg) make it easy to carry throughout the day.
Connectivity and Ports
Both laptops feature a good selection of ports. The Acer Swift Go 14 2026 includes Thunderbolt 4, USB-C, USB-A, HDMI, and a headphone jack. The Samsung Galaxy Book 3 Pro offers Thunderbolt 4, USB-C, microSD card slot, and a headphone jack, catering to diverse connectivity needs.
Operating System and Features
The Acer Swift Go 14 2026 runs Windows 11, providing a familiar interface and compatibility with a wide range of software. It includes features like a fingerprint reader and Dolby Atmos speakers for enhanced security and multimedia experience.
The Samsung Galaxy Book 3 Pro also runs Windows 11 and offers features like an S-Pen stylus, which is ideal for creative professionals. Its AMOLED display supports touch input, adding versatility.
Price and Value
The Acer Swift Go 14 2026 is positioned at a competitive price point, offering high-end features for a mid-range budget. The Samsung Galaxy Book 3 Pro tends to be slightly more expensive, reflecting its premium display and stylus capabilities.
Conclusion
Choosing between the Acer Swift Go 14 2026 and Samsung Galaxy Book 3 Pro depends on your priorities. If you value a larger OLED display and versatile hardware options, the Acer is an excellent choice. For those who prefer a 4K AMOLED touch display with stylus support and a sleek design, the Samsung Galaxy Book 3 Pro stands out. Both are powerful, portable, and well-equipped for modern computing needs.
